<h2 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Market Overview: Growth, Trends & Post-COVID Recovery</strong></h2>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The <strong>Saudi real estate service market</strong> has matured rapidly, fueled by increased government spending, urban migration, and rising demand for smart, integrated infrastructure. According to <strong>Ken Research</strong>, the total value of real estate transactions in 2023 exceeded <strong>SAR 300 billion</strong>, showing a 15% year-on-year growth.</p>

<p style="text-align: justify;">Key market trends include:</p>
<ul style="text-align: justify;">
<li><strong>Post-COVID recovery:</strong> Full resumption of construction and leasing activities.</li>
<li><strong>Digital adoption:</strong> Platforms using AI, blockchain, and IoT to enhance service delivery.</li>
<li><strong>Regulatory modernization:</strong> Introduction of the Real Estate General Authority (REGA) for standardizing practices.</li>
</ul>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, lingering supply chain disruptions, inflationary pressures, and fluctuating interest rates continue to strain operating margins for real estate service providers.</p>
<h2 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Major Challenges in the KSA Real Estate Service Industry</strong></h2>
<ul style="text-align: justify;">
<li><strong>Regulatory Challenges in Real Estate Licensing: </strong>Despite regulatory efforts, inconsistent real estate licensing procedures remain a hurdle. Foreign firms face extended processing times, local partnership mandates, and varying municipal interpretations. These regulatory bottlenecks slow down market entry and increase compliance costs.</li>
<li><strong>Talent Shortage and Workforce Localization (Saudization): </strong>KSA’s real estate sector suffers from a shortage of skilled local professionals. With over 60% of the workforce comprising expatriates, there is an urgent need for talent development in fields like valuation, leasing, and urban planning.</li>
<li><strong>Infrastructure Gaps in Emerging Developments: </strong>New real estate zones, especially around mega-projects, lack robust supporting infrastructure like roads, electricity, and high-speed connectivity. This impedes the delivery of facilities management services and lowers tenant satisfaction.</li>
</ul>

<h2 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Strategic Solutions to Overcome Challenges</strong></h2>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Streamlining Real Estate Regulations</strong></h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;">To resolve regulatory issues, digitization of approval workflows is key. A unified portal linking REGA, municipal authorities, and licensing boards would dramatically improve efficiency.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Real estate firms are encouraged to:</p>
<ul style="text-align: justify;">
<li>Partner with local consultancies for compliance.</li>
<li>Participate in REGA-driven training programs.</li>
<li>Utilize e-platforms for fast-tracking permits and licensing.</li>
</ul>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Building a Local Real Estate Talent Pipeline</strong></h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Strategic partnerships between universities, industry leaders, and global certification bodies (like RICS) can bridge the real estate talent gap. Firms should:</p>
<ul style="text-align: justify;">
<li>Launch in-house academies for leasing, valuation, and FM.</li>
<li>Offer paid internships with guaranteed employment.</li>
<li>Incentivize certification and continuing education.</li>
</ul>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Example:</strong> A top Riyadh-based real estate company reported a 40% increase in local hires after implementing a six-month training program.</p>

<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Infrastructure-Integrated Service Planning</strong></h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Real estate companies should align closely with municipal planners and utility providers to ensure synchronized service rollout. Technologies like:</p>
<ul style="text-align: justify;">
<li>GIS for property mapping</li>
<li>IoT for predictive maintenance</li>
<li>Off-grid modular infrastructure</li>
</ul>
<p style="text-align: justify;">…can bridge service gaps and reduce dependency on delayed government infrastructure.</p>
